On Mon, Sep 24, 2001 at 08:44:19PM +0200, David Faure wrote:
> On Mercredi 5 Septembre 2001 10:41, Jacek Stolarczyk wrote:
> > 1) The underlining line in "underlined text" appeared _very_ thin on the
> > printout. It looked OK on the screen so it seems it's not scaled to the
> > current resolution
> 
> Qt bug... to be checked whether Qt3 improves this.
> 
> > 2) The cell borders in a table are not overlapped. I expected to get a
> > framed table with lines separating the cells but I got 6 (the
> > table was 2x3) separate boxes (rectangles) on the screen and on
> > the printout.
> 
> Interesting, I thought this was on purpose. Anyway, I don't maintain tables ;)

The purpose is that the cells overlap so you see one line between each cell.
The borders on tables has to be rethought, yes.
